logo articoloAlbo Pretorio On Line per Joomla 1.5 è stata una bella esperienza di confronto, prima di tutto con la Comunità di italiana di Joomla e poi con il mondo della Pubblica Amministrazione che ha utilizzato il frutto di questo impegno: Comuni, Province, Regioni, Scuole ed Istituti di Iscruzione, Enti Parco, Unioni di Comuni e tantissimi altri soggetti che formano questo mondo. Il risultato del primo lavoro fu presentato in un articolo qui su Joomla.it "Albo Pretorio On Line per la Pubblica Amministrazione. Una storia di Jooma"  , e presentato anche ad un Joomla Day. Gli enti censiti ufficiosamente che hanno utilizzato o utilizzano Albo sono ad oggi oltre 590, e sono in crescità.

Queste attenzioni, le richieste ricevute  e le attese di tanti che sollecitavano l'adeguamento dell'applicazione alle nuove versioni di Joomla richiedevano la responsabilità e l'impegno di poter portare tutti nella nuova dimesione di Joomla 2.5 e 3. Per la verità l'intermittente arrivo di nuove e diverse versioni di Joomla non ha facilitato questa transizione, più volte provata e ricominciata da capo. Ma questa è acqua passata. Ora siamo qui per gestire il passaggio alla nuova dimensione. Per questo era indispensabile la nuova versione di Albo Pretorio On Line per Joomla 2.5 e 3 che trovate qui per il download insieme al suo fedele modulo Ultimi Atti che l'accompagna nelle prestazioni.

Ma è tempo di agire e quindi ecco qui quanto occorre per la migrazione degli archivi di Albo dalla versione per Joomla 1.5 a Joomla 2.5 e 3.

 

Istruzioni per la migrazione di Albo Pretorio On Line per Joomla 1.5 a Joomla 2.5 - 3

    1. Requisiti. Avere un sito con Joomla 2.5 o 3. Aver installato sul sito almeno la nuova versione di Albo Pretorio On Line by Vales per Joomla 2.5 e 3 v2 beta 1.1.0 o successive. Avere il vecchio Albo Pretorio su un sito Joomla 1.5  diverso da quello principale, normalmente installato su una sottocartella del sito principale.
    2. Attenzione questa procedura è consentita solo per installazioni di Albo Pretorio On Line per Joomla 2.5 e 3 appena installate e quindi senza alcun dato caricato. Se ci sono dati caricati la procedura segnala la cosa ed avverte che questi dati saranno tutti cancellati.
    3. E' consigliato ai fini della compatibilità della migrazione di aver caricato gli utenti di Albo per Joomla 1.5 sul nuovo sito Joomla 2.5 o 3 con gli stessi username della vecchia versione. Questo consente di avere la piena compatibilità della migrazione. Altrimenti il vecchio log di attività non avrà i referimenti a chi ha inserito gli atti.
    4. Ci sono due possibilità relative alla vecchia installazione di Albo Pretorio On Line per Joomla 1.5:
      a) il vecchio Albo utilizza lo stesso database del sito principale con un prefisso delle tabelle diverso dal prefisso delle tabelle del sito principale.
      b) il vecchio Albo utilizza un diverso database dello stesso server oppure è su un altro server
    5. Nel caso a) l'unica operazione preliminale necessaria è procurarsi in prefisso del tabelle del database del sito che ospita il vecchi Albo. Questo se non conosciuto può essere trovato andando in Configurazione  e poi nella tab Server dove nel quadro Configurazione database sarà leggibile il Prefisso database. Annotarselo. Chi si trova in questa condizione può passare direttamente al punto 9)
    6. Nel caso b) se le tabelle di Albo Pretorio On Line per Joomla 1.5 non sono presenti nel database del sito della nuova installazione occorre procurarsele e trasferirle manualmente sul nuovo sito con l'aiuto di phpmyadmin.

      migrazione phpMyAdmin 1
    7. Per fare l'operazione del punto 6) si accede con phpmyadmin  al database del sito del vecchio Albo si clicca sul nome del database nella colonna a sinistra (attenzione a questo passaggio non cliccate sul bottone esporta al centro in alto nell'altra finestra altrimenti esportate il database). Quindi dopo aver cliccato sul nome del database nella colonna di sinistra, nella vista seguente che elenca tutte le tabelle esistenti di sceglie il comando esporta .

      migrazione phpMyAdmin 2Le 8 tabelle da copiare sono:

      chronoforms_albo_log
      chronoforms_allegati_10
      chronoforms_atto_10
      chronoforms_categoria_10
      chronoforms_enti
      chronoforms_sezione_10
      chronoforms_utenti
      users

      I nomi di tutte le tabelle saranno preceduti dal prefisso  (es. jos_ ) che anche in questo caso va annotato .

      migrazione phpMyAdmin 3
      Fra le opzioni mostrate di sceglie personalizzato. Le altre opzioni proposte di default dovrebbero andare bene. Comunque assicuratevi che l'output sia su file, il formato del file SQL, la compatibilità NONE che dovrebbe andare bene per tutte, sia spuntata struttura e dati, CREATE TABLE con IF NOT EXISTS
      e AUTO_INCREMENT, la funzione di da usare sia INSERT con il caso "entrambi i precedenti". Lunghezza massima della query mostra un numero, forse 5000,  inserite un numero abbastanza grande anche 1.000.000. Date il comando esegui ed al termine del lavoro vi sarà proposto di salvare il file nel vostro computer.
      migrazione phpMyAdmin 4
      migrazione phpMyAdmin 5
      migrazione phpMyAdmin 6
      migrazione phpMyAdmin 7
    8. Ora è il momento di accedere con phpmyadmin al database del sito che ospita il nuovo Albo con Joomla 2.5 o 3. Entrate normalmente cliccate sul nome del database in uso e la finestra seguente mostrerà l'elenco delle tabelle presenti. Controllate che non vi siano già presenti tabelle con lo stesso nome di quelle che stiamo importando. Eventualmente rinominatele. Cliccare poi su Importa.

      migrazione phpMyAdmin 72


      Controllate che il set dei caratteri sia utf-8, il file SQL e la compatibilità NONE. Controllate che la dimensione massima del file accettato sia compatibile con il file creato al punto precedente, altrimenti sarà necessario ripetere il punto 6) più volte selezionando meno tabelle contemporaneamente, le più grandi sono chronoforms_albo_log, chronoforms_allegati_10, chronoforms_atto_10 , quindi vanno ripartite opportunamente. Se tutto è andato a buon fine troverete nel database le 8 tabelle appena importate. Uscite da phpmyadmin.

      migrazione phpMyAdmin 8
    9. E' ora di pensare al salvataggio dei file allegati presenti nella cartella degli allegati del vecchio sito questi si trovano nella cartella che troverete indicata andando in configurazione del vecchio Albo. C'erano due possibilità cartella images/allegati_10 oppure /components/com_chronocontact/uploads/allegati_10. La cosa qui è semplice si utilizza il proprio programma per accedere ai file del sito in modalità FTP. Si individua la cartella degli allegati e si trasferisce sul computer. Questo processo richiederà un po' più di tempo in relazione al numero ed alla dimensione degli allegati presenti.
    10. Si procede ora all'operazione inversa via FTP, cioè il trasferimento dei file allegati dalla cartella del computer alla cartella dei file nel sito del nuovo Albo Pretorio On Line, essa sarà posizionata obbligatoriamente nella cartella sul percorso images/allegati_10.
    11. Completata l'operazione del punto 10) si accede al backend di Joomla del sito del nuovo Albo. Si va in Componenti, Chronoforms5. Nell'elenco dei form che viene mostrato di cerca il form con nome migrazione_da_albo_J15. Nella colonna al centro sulla stessa riga del form si clicca sul link View Form. Se tutto è stato predisposto nel modo detto sopra appariranno dei messaggi di avvertimento e sarà richiesto di inserire due volte il prefisso che abbiamo annotato nelle precedenti operazioni. Inserito il prefisso si clicca su Submit e, qui si farà la "mia nobilitate" o la "mia Caporetto".

      migrazione phpMyAdmin 9

    12. Se tutto è andato come previsto si può accedere dal frontend a Finestra di Avvio. Da li andando in modifica Utenti dovranno essere assegnati agli utenti trasferiti i permessi sulle funzioni di Albo, quelli sulle categorie importate dovrebbero essere già presenti ed uguali a quelli delle vecchia versione.

Auguro a tutti una buona migrazione ed un buon proseguimento del lavoro con Albo Pretorio On Line per Joomla  2.5 e 3 by Vales. Per ogni problema potete postare nel forum dedicato qui su Joomla.it http://forum.joomla.it/index.php/board,89.0.html,89.0.html .

Il demo della nuova versione di Albo Pretorio On Line lo trove qua http://valesweb.altervista.org/joomla3